IV. The Only Answer, Paragraph 8
8 The introduction of abilities into being was the beginning of uncertainty, because abilities are potentials, not accomplishments. Your abilities are useless in the presence of God’s accomplishments, and also of yours. Accomplishments are results that have been achieved. When they are perfect, abilities are meaningless. It is curious that the perfect must now be perfected. In fact, it is impossible. Remember, however, that when you put yourself in an impossible situation you believe that the impossible is possible.
God created me perfect. He created me as part of Himself. There is no such thing as abilities in creation, because all is accomplished. With the introduction of the separation idea, abilities were needed because in separation there was now the illusion of imperfection and so there was the illusion that something needed to be done.
I am still perfect and still in God and I do not need to learn anything because in the Kingdom there is not even the idea of learning. However, since I do not believe I am in the Kingdom, since I believe I am separate from the Kingdom, I have placed myself in the truly bizarre position of needing to become perfect and so I need abilities and I need to develop them.
An example of an ability that I developed is listening to Holy Spirit. When I began this process it was pretty shaky. I tried different methods until I found what works for me, which is meditative writing. It sounds pretty cut and dried. Try this. No. Try that. No. Oh, Ok, this works. But it is never easy with ego because ego is questions, doubts and fears.
So I would try meditating in the usual way and would fail. I failed over and over. I watched everyone else succeed and report these wonderful results, and yet, I could not do it. I felt like a failure and I felt like I was the one who was unforgiven. In other words, I suffered.
That’s the way it works with ego. Ego would have kept me in this process forever if it could, trying one method and then another, reading books on meditation, listening to meditation CDs, taking meditation classes. But I had a burning desire to hear that Voice and enough willingness to keep that desire alive.
Finally I turned from the ego and sought help from my Guide. I didn’t even know I had been trying to learn from the ego what the ego was determined I not learn. I didn’t know that I was finally turning to my true teacher. All I knew was that I still wanted it but that I gave up trying to give it to myself. Surrender is what allowed the Holy Spirit to help me. He can never take from us what we want to keep, or give to us what we are determined to give to ourselves. But the moment we truly want His help, it is done.
Once I discovered that I could speak to and listen to the Holy Spirit as I wrote, it only remained to develop this ability further. I did this through daily practice and even that felt like suffering at first. This is because the ego joined me in the practice, constantly criticizing and discouraging my attempts. But because I truly desire this communication, I learned how to become more fully surrendered to the process.
Actually, looking back on it, I realize it was never hard to hear His Voice. It only seemed hard because I was trying to listen to two completely opposed Voices at the same time. When I finally chose the one Voice I wanted, it became easy and now I look forward to each morning sitting here with Him. While I was at the hospital with my son I was not able to give this time to Spirit and I missed it.
So this is an ability I developed. I learned to hear the Voice for God and to write what I heard. This is a ridiculous thing. How could I not hear that Voice? It is in me. It speaks to me all through the day. It is the only thing that is real. It is both God’s Will and my will. And yet, I had to develop the ability to hear clearly, and still I am further developing the ability to hear even more clearly. It is an insane situation made necessary through insane choices.
